Description

At Excel Society, we’re not just crunching numbers—we’re building a community grounded in care, precision, and purpose. We’re looking for a Senior Accountant who’s organized, detail-oriented, and motivated to support the Controller in overseeing the company’s financial operations and ensuring accurate and timely financial reporting.

If you enjoy bringing structure to complex processes, thrive in a collaborative environment, and want your work to contribute to something bigger—this is the role for you.

🕘Work Hours: Monday to Friday, 8:30 AM – 4:30 PM (75 hours biweekly)

🔍What You’ll Do:

- Make timely and informed decisions that consider facts, goals, constraints, risk, Excel Society Values, and the Excel Advantage.

- Oversee the maintenance of books of account (including but not limited to preparing cheques, coding and posting invoices, preparing deposits, journal entries, reconciliations, client spending, cash card accounting, MasterCard accounting, petty cash).

- Assist in preparing monthly / quarterly financial statements and financial statement/variance analysis for the Senior Leadership Team, Audit Committee, and Board of Directors ensuring adherence to Accounting Standards for Not-For-Profits (ASNPO).

- Liaise with department staff and support them in bookkeeping needs related to their program areas.

- Oversee internal system of handling funds. Ensure proper controls are in place and are followed.

- Maintain year-end working papers and spreadsheets and assist with preparation for any audits or independent reviews with support from the Director of Finance.

- Participate in the preparation of the budget and financial forecasts, institute and maintain other planning and control procedures (including the cost accounting system) and analyze and report variances to the Assistant Director of Finance, the Director of Finance, the Senior Leadership team, and the Audit Committee.

- Quarterly and annual financial reporting on contracts (PDD, AHS, NWT, Nunavut).

- Oversee issuing of cheques / payment of invoices.

- Exert care and control over assets and records and establish procedures for safeguarding assets under the control of the Finance department.

- Maintain up-to-date, complete, and systematic filing system to support bookkeeping and financial records.

- Responsible for GST tax compliance.

✅What You Bring:

- Familiar with Not-For-Profit Accounting Standards.

- Excellent problem identification, problem solving, computer, verbal and written communication, interpersonal, organizational, time management, and customer service skills.

- Proficiency with progressing payroll.

- Excellent working knowledge of UKG, Sage, and MS365.

- Accuracy and attention to detail while working under tight deadlines.

- Able to build and maintain lasting relationships with departments and key business partners.

- Ability to follow through and complete overlapping projects.

- Satisfactory criminal record check.
